:root{
  --mono-bg:#061E3F;--mono-bg-2:#0E1A2B;--mono-card:rgba(14,26,43,.78);--mono-card-2:rgba(6,30,63,.72);--mono-accent:#00BFFF;--mono-text:#E6F7FF;--mono-muted:#9FCFE8;--mono-soft:#F5F7FA;--mono-border:rgba(159,207,232,.16);--mono-shadow:0 24px 70px rgba(0,0,0,.28);--mono-radius:24px;--mono-radius-sm:16px;--mono-max:1180px;--mono-font:Inter, ui-sans-serif, system-ui, -apple-system, BlinkMacSystemFont, "Segoe UI", sans-serif;
}
*{box-sizing:border-box}html{scroll-behavior:smooth}body{margin:0;background:radial-gradient(circle at 20% 0%,rgba(0,191,255,.16),transparent 34%),linear-gradient(180deg,var(--mono-bg),#04152c 50%,#061a35);color:var(--mono-text);font-family:var(--mono-font);font-size:17px;line-height:1.7}a{color:inherit;text-decoration:none}img{max-width:100%;height:auto}p{color:var(--mono-muted);margin:0 0 1.1rem}.mono-container{width:min(var(--mono-max),calc(100% - 40px));margin-inline:auto}.mono-site-header{position:sticky;top:0;z-index:50;background:rgba(6,30,63,.82);backdrop-filter:blur(18px);border-bottom:1px solid var(--mono-border)}.mono-header-inner{display:flex;align-items:center;justify-content:space-between;min-height:78px;gap:24px}.mono-logo{font-weight:800;letter-spacing:-.04em;font-size:1.45rem}.mono-logo span{color:var(--mono-accent)}.mono-nav{display:flex;align-items:center;gap:22px}.mono-nav a{font-size:.94rem;color:var(--mono-muted);transition:.2s}.mono-nav a:hover{color:var(--mono-text)}.mono-btn,.wp-block-button__link,.mono-form button{display:inline-flex;align-items:center;justify-content:center;gap:10px;border:1px solid rgba(0,191,255,.38);border-radius:999px;padding:12px 20px;background:linear-gradient(135deg,var(--mono-accent),#49d5ff);color:#03152a!important;font-weight:800;line-height:1.2;box-shadow:0 16px 40px rgba(0,191,255,.22);transition:.2s}.mono-btn:hover,.wp-block-button__link:hover,.mono-form button:hover{transform:translateY(-1px);box-shadow:0 20px 54px rgba(0,191,255,.3)}.mono-btn.secondary{background:rgba(255,255,255,.04);color:var(--mono-text)!important;box-shadow:none;border-color:var(--mono-border)}.mono-mobile-toggle{display:none;background:none;border:1px solid var(--mono-border);color:var(--mono-text);border-radius:12px;padding:9px 12px}.mono-hero{position:relative;overflow:hidden;padding:96px 0 56px}.mono-hero:before{content:"";position:absolute;inset:0;background-image:linear-gradient(rgba(255,255,255,.035) 1px,transparent 1px),linear-gradient(90deg,rgba(255,255,255,.035) 1px,transparent 1px);background-size:54px 54px;mask-image:linear-gradient(to bottom,#000,transparent 74%);pointer-events:none}.mono-hero-grid{position:relative;display:grid;grid-template-columns:1.05fr .95fr;gap:44px;align-items:center}.mono-eyebrow{display:inline-flex;align-items:center;gap:8px;padding:7px 12px;border:1px solid var(--mono-border);border-radius:999px;background:rgba(255,255,255,.035);color:var(--mono-muted);font-size:.82rem;font-weight:700;text-transform:uppercase;letter-spacing:.08em}.mono-eyebrow:before{content:"";width:8px;height:8px;border-radius:999px;background:var(--mono-accent);box-shadow:0 0 24px var(--mono-accent)}h1,h2,h3,h4,h5,h6{color:var(--mono-text);letter-spacing:-.04em;line-height:1.05;margin:0 0 18px}h1{font-size:clamp(2.7rem,6vw,5.35rem)}h2{font-size:clamp(2rem,4vw,3.45rem)}h3{font-size:clamp(1.35rem,2.3vw,1.8rem)}.mono-lead{font-size:clamp(1.05rem,1.7vw,1.28rem);max-width:760px;color:#cdefff}.mono-actions{display:flex;gap:12px;flex-wrap:wrap;margin-top:28px}.mono-section{padding:72px 0}.mono-section.small{padding:46px 0}.mono-section-head{max-width:820px;margin-bottom:30px}.mono-kicker{color:var(--mono-accent);font-weight:800;letter-spacing:.09em;text-transform:uppercase;font-size:.82rem;margin-bottom:10px}.mono-grid{display:grid;gap:18px}.mono-grid.two{grid-template-columns:repeat(2,minmax(0,1fr))}.mono-grid.three{grid-template-columns:repeat(3,minmax(0,1fr))}.mono-grid.four{grid-template-columns:repeat(4,minmax(0,1fr))}.mono-card,.wp-block-group.is-style-mono-card{background:linear-gradient(180deg,rgba(255,255,255,.055),rgba(255,255,255,.025));border:1px solid var(--mono-border);border-radius:var(--mono-radius);padding:24px;box-shadow:var(--mono-shadow)}.mono-card h3{margin-bottom:10px}.mono-card ul,.mono-content ul{padding-left:20px;color:var(--mono-muted)}.mono-card li,.mono-content li{margin:.35rem 0}.mono-card .mono-tag,.mono-tag{display:inline-flex;margin:0 6px 6px 0;padding:5px 10px;border-radius:999px;border:1px solid var(--mono-border);color:var(--mono-muted);font-size:.78rem}.mono-visual{min-height:410px;border:1px solid var(--mono-border);border-radius:32px;background:radial-gradient(circle at 30% 20%,rgba(0,191,255,.26),transparent 30%),linear-gradient(135deg,rgba(255,255,255,.08),rgba(255,255,255,.025));box-shadow:var(--mono-shadow);padding:28px;display:flex;flex-direction:column;justify-content:center;gap:14px}.mono-node{display:flex;align-items:center;justify-content:space-between;gap:16px;border:1px solid var(--mono-border);border-radius:18px;background:rgba(6,30,63,.55);padding:14px 16px;color:var(--mono-text);font-weight:700}.mono-node small{display:block;color:var(--mono-muted);font-weight:500}.mono-flow{display:grid;gap:12px}.mono-flow-line{height:26px;width:1px;background:linear-gradient(var(--mono-accent),transparent);margin:auto}.mono-content{max-width:800px}.mono-content.alignwide{max-width:var(--mono-max)}.mono-content .wp-block-heading{margin-top:2rem}.mono-content a{color:var(--mono-accent);font-weight:700}.mono-content blockquote{border-left:3px solid var(--mono-accent);margin:28px 0;padding:16px 0 16px 22px;background:rgba(255,255,255,.025);border-radius:0 16px 16px 0}.mono-article-layout{display:grid;grid-template-columns:minmax(0,760px) 320px;gap:44px;align-items:start}.mono-sidebar{position:sticky;top:105px}.mono-meta{display:flex;gap:10px;flex-wrap:wrap;color:var(--mono-muted);font-size:.92rem}.mono-archive-grid{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:18px}.mono-post-card{display:flex;flex-direction:column;min-height:100%;overflow:hidden}.mono-post-card .thumb{aspect-ratio:16/10;background:linear-gradient(135deg,rgba(0,191,255,.16),rgba(255,255,255,.04));border-radius:18px;margin-bottom:18px}.mono-site-footer{border-top:1px solid var(--mono-border);padding:52px 0 30px;background:rgba(4,15,33,.55)}.mono-footer-grid{display:grid;grid-template-columns:1.3fr repeat(3,1fr);gap:28px}.mono-footer-links{display:grid;gap:9px}.mono-footer-links a{color:var(--mono-muted);font-size:.94rem}.mono-footer-bottom{margin-top:36px;padding-top:20px;border-top:1px solid var(--mono-border);display:flex;justify-content:space-between;gap:18px;color:var(--mono-muted);font-size:.9rem}.mono-form{display:grid;gap:14px}.mono-form label{display:grid;gap:6px;color:var(--mono-text);font-weight:700}.mono-form input,.mono-form select,.mono-form textarea{width:100%;border:1px solid var(--mono-border);background:rgba(3,21,42,.58);border-radius:14px;color:var(--mono-text);padding:13px 14px;font:inherit}.mono-form textarea{min-height:150px}.mono-form input:focus,.mono-form select:focus,.mono-form textarea:focus{outline:2px solid rgba(0,191,255,.35);border-color:rgba(0,191,255,.5)}.mono-table{width:100%;border-collapse:collapse;overflow:hidden;border-radius:18px;border:1px solid var(--mono-border)}.mono-table th,.mono-table td{padding:14px;border-bottom:1px solid var(--mono-border);text-align:left;color:var(--mono-muted)}.mono-table th{color:var(--mono-text);background:rgba(255,255,255,.04)}.screen-reader-text{position:absolute;left:-9999px}.wp-block-separator{border:0;border-top:1px solid var(--mono-border);margin:36px 0}.wp-block-image img{border-radius:var(--mono-radius);border:1px solid var(--mono-border)}
@media (max-width: 980px){.mono-hero-grid,.mono-grid.two,.mono-grid.three,.mono-grid.four,.mono-article-layout,.mono-footer-grid{grid-template-columns:1fr}.mono-archive-grid{grid-template-columns:repeat(2,minmax(0,1fr))}.mono-sidebar{position:static}.mono-nav{display:none;position:absolute;top:78px;left:0;right:0;padding:18px 20px;background:rgba(6,30,63,.96);border-bottom:1px solid var(--mono-border);flex-direction:column;align-items:flex-start}.mono-nav.is-open{display:flex}.mono-mobile-toggle{display:inline-flex}.mono-visual{min-height:300px}.mono-hero{padding-top:70px}}
@media (max-width: 640px){.mono-container{width:min(100% - 28px,var(--mono-max))}.mono-archive-grid{grid-template-columns:1fr}.mono-actions{flex-direction:column}.mono-btn,.wp-block-button__link{width:100%}.mono-section{padding:54px 0}.mono-footer-bottom{flex-direction:column}body{font-size:16px}}
